Liquid A has a density of 0.7 g/cm³.
Liquid B has a density of 1.6 g/cm³.
140 g of liquid A and 128 g of liquid B are mixed to make liquid C.
Work out the density of liquid C.

Answer:

0.957g/cm3

Step-by-step explanation:

Density*Volume= mass

volume=mass/density

Liquid A= 140g/0.7

=200

Liquid B= 128/1.6

=1.6

Volume of liquid C= 200+80

=280

Mass of liquid C= 140+ 128

=268

Liquid C's density= mass/volume

=268/280

=0.957g/cm3
